Output 42969316923fdcc71a6da0a7afe22ee2d960cd574f59d3faf34e7270c13acf5a:1

value
12855705
script pubkey
OP_0 OP_PUSHBYTES_20 ba9a0c1f4d06a59ae4b5b002f4190665304057df
address
bc1qh2dqc86dq6je4e94kqp0gxgxv5cyq47lh40wq9
transaction
42969316923fdcc71a6da0a7afe22ee2d960cd574f59d3faf34e7270c13acf5a
spent
true